Burundi Coffee
Burundi produces some of East Africa’s most vibrant and clean coffees, with a growing reputation for quality in the specialty coffee world. Grown at high altitudes in regions such as Kayanza and Ngozi, coffee is cultivated by smallholder farmers managing small plots, often with just a few hundred trees.
Most coffees are processed at centralised washing stations, where careful cherry selection, controlled fermentation and slow drying on raised beds contribute to the clarity and structure Burundi is known for.
The cup profile is typically bright and juicy, with notes of citrus, stone fruit and florals, supported by balanced sweetness and a clean, refreshing finish. These characteristics make Burundi coffees particularly well suited to filter brewing.
